What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In Perry Hall, MD, a urine drug screen (UDS) serves as a crucial diagnostic technique that examines a urine sample to identify drugs and their byproducts. This technique stands out as the most prevalent testing method within workplace and regulated environments, primarily because it is non-invasive, economically viable, and capable of detecting a vast array of substances across an effective detection window.

  • For regulated testing, adherence to chain-of-custody protocols during collection is mandatory.
  • The test identifies both the original drugs and/or their metabolites excreted in the urine.
  • It signifies previous substance exposure within a discernible detection window but does not reveal current intoxication levels.

Why Organizations Use Urine Drug Screening

  • Utilization of pre-employment testing practices to ensure a safe and drug-free working environment.
  • The implementation of random, post-accident, suspicion-based, and return-to-duty evaluations.
  • Adherence to mandatory regulatory compliance in industries where safety is paramount.
  • Tracking adherence to prescribed medications or approved treatment plans, particularly in Perry Hall, MD.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Perry Hall, MD, donors provide a urine specimen typically within a secure container, with observation depending on specific program guidelines.
  • Specimen validity tests, including checks for creatinine, specific gravity, and pH levels, are often conducted in Perry Hall, MD to verify sample authenticity.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• An initial immunoassay screening offers a rapid and economical assessment tool.
  • Positives are confirmed using advanced meth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S to ensure precision.
  • Defined cutoff levels expressed in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L) determine the results as positive or negative.

Detection Windows

In Perry Hall, MD, the capability of detecting substances varies based on factors like the substance type, usage frequency, metabolic rate, hydration levels, body composition, and the test's sensitivity. Usually, drugs can be identified within 1–3 days, though entities like cannabinoids might persist longer for regular users.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In the state of Perry Hall, MD, hair drug screening utilizes a small sample of hair to identify drugs and their metabolites that have been present in the bloodstream and subsequently incorporated into the hair shaft. With hair growing at a slow rate and storing drug metabolites for extended periods, this method offers one of the longest detection windows among various testing techniques, making it particularly effective for detecting chronic or long-term drug usage.

  • Typically, 100–120 strands are cut close to the scalp, approximately 1.5 inches of hair length is used for the test.
  • This method can reflect around a 90-day period of potential drug exposure, contingent on the length of hair sampled.
  • In Perry Hall, MD, a broad array of substances such as am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P can be tested.

Why Organizations Use Hair Drug Screening

  • In Perry Hall, MD, hair tests are performed during pre-employment to identify sustained substance use habits.
  • Utilized for random or regular tests in industries with high safety standards.
  • Applied in monitoring for adherence to treatment or legal requirements.
  • Helps confirm abstinence or compliance with company drug-free policies.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Perry Hall, MD, a small sample, typically near the crown, is carefully trimmed by a collector following chain-of-custody procedures.
  • The sample is then securely sealed, properly labeled, and sent to a certified laboratory.
  • Should scalp hair be insufficient, body hair serves as an alternate collection site.

Testing Methodology

  • Initial washing and preparation of samples to eliminate potential external contaminants occur first.
  • Screening begins with the application of immunoassay technology for detecting broad categories of drugs.
  • To ensure precise identification, positive screens undergo confirmation using GC/MS or LC/MS/MS testing methodologies.
  • Cutoff levels are determined in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g) following SAMHSA and industry standards especially pertinent in Perry Hall, MD.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: In Perry Hall, MD, if no drug/metabolites are identified above the lab cutoff level, the result is considered negative.
  • Positive: If drugs/metabolites are detected and substantiated through additional testing, the result is positive.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Specimens that are insufficient or contaminated may necessitate another sample collection.

Detection Windows

Hair drug testing prevailing in Perry Hall, MD boasts the longest detection window current among testing approaches. A typical hair sample of 1.5 inches can exhibit around 90 days of prior drug exposure. Extended samples can lengthen the window, subject to the growth rate, approximately 0.5 inches monthly. Unlike urine or oral testing, hair assessments are not feasible for recent drug usage (within the last 7–10 days).

Key Considerations for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ing

  • Although DOT guidelines presently don't enforce hair testing, ongoing evaluations by the Department of Transportation and HHS are considering future adoption.
  • Outside of DOT mandates, hair testing is upheld as effective in identifying long-term drug usage.
  • Qualified specialists should oversee collection, maintaining documented chain-of-custody compliance.
  • Laboratory accuracy and dependability are endorsed through S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A accreditation in Perry Hall, MD.

Benefits

  • Hair samples offer a significantly long detection timeline (up to 90 days or even more).
  • More challenging to adulterate or substitute compared to urine specimens, providing trusted results.
  • Reveals a comprehensive pattern of chronic or habitual usage.
  • Sample collection is straightforward, non-intrusive, and avoids the need for restroom facilities, valuable in Perry Hall, MD settings.
